Account Executive, Group Tickets & Hospitality
About This Position
Join the San Diego Padres as an Account Executive, Group Tickets & Hospitality in San Diego, CA. You will drive sales of group tickets, hospitality spaces, and suites while delivering top‑tier service to corporate and private groups.
Key Responsibilities
- Prospect, negotiate, and close group ticket and hospitality sales to meet or exceed revenue targets.
- Develop and maintain relationships with corporate clients, sports clubs, and event planners.
- Coordinate with the Director of Group Tickets & Hospitality to create customized packages and promotional offers.
- Prepare proposals, contracts, and detailed sales reports.
- Assist in the planning and execution of on‑site hospitality experiences, ensuring a premium guest experience.
- Track market trends and competitor activity to identify new business opportunities.
Qualifications
- Strong interpersonal and communication skills with a proven sales record.
- Experience in ticket sales, hospitality, or related customer‑facing roles preferred.
- Ability to work flexible hours, including evenings and weekends during the baseball season.
- Proficient with CRM software and Microsoft Office suite.
- Team‑oriented mindset with a goal‑driven attitude.
Compensation & Benefits
Base salary $55,610.66 per year plus performance‑based incentives. Comprehensive benefits package includes health, dental, vision, 401(k) match, and employee ticket privileges.
